§ 49-7-187 — Accreditation

Tennessee·Title 49
(a)(1) Each governing board of a public institution of higher education in this state shall regularly update the institution's policies and practices regarding institutional accreditation to conform with changes made by the United States department of education or by the United States congress.
(2)By December 31, 2024, each governing board of a public institution of higher education in this state shall identify and determine the institutional accrediting agencies or associations eligible to serve as an accreditor. Such institutional accrediting agencies or associations must be recognized by the database created and maintained by the United States department of education.
